To give your basement a nice new look, you should stain the floors. Staining is a less expensive way to greatly improve the look of your concrete floors. Stains also make the concrete stronger and easier to clean. Look for stains to add shine and lustre. This is an easy way to give the appearance of a much more costly floor.

Bathrooms should always have a ventilation fan or a window. When steam is generated from the shower, mold could possibly form. Bathroom repainting isn't enough to get rid of mold permanently. It is better to make a change to prevent it from forming in the first place. Install a window or ventilation, to dehumidify your space.

Soundproofing your interior walls is a great investment. Doing every wall is luxurious, but not smart economically or technically. The most important rooms to soundproof are bathrooms, bedrooms and equipment rooms. As long as you do not have an open floor plan, another great room to soundproof is the kitchen.

Look into wood cabinets if you are considering replacing your cabinetry. Hard woods are incredibly resilient; they'll last for decades without breaking. Cabinets are commonly made of maple, cherry and oak. All such wood types are suitable for staining, so in the future if you decide to change up the color, this is easily accomplished.
